The Science Behind High-Protein Breakfasts
Your body uses protein to build and repair tissues, synthesize hormones, and fuel a wide range of cellular processes. The timing and quantity of your protein intake can significantly impact these functions. While the body can only utilize a certain amount of protein for muscle synthesis in a single sitting, the exact amount is influenced by the food source.
Absorption vs. Anabolic Response
Early research, often based on fast-digesting whey protein, suggested an upper threshold of 20–40 grams per meal for muscle protein synthesis (MPS). However, newer evidence shows a more nuanced picture. When consuming whole foods, which are digested more slowly, a higher protein load can sustain the anabolic response for a longer duration. This means a 50-gram breakfast from a solid meal is more likely to be effectively utilized than a fast-digesting supplement of the same amount.
Appetite and Weight Management
Eating a high-protein breakfast significantly boosts satiety, the feeling of fullness. This is because protein activates hormones like peptide YY and GLP-1, which suppress appetite. A protein-rich start to the day can lead to a lower total calorie intake later on and help reduce cravings for sugary or high-fat snacks. A study in women showed that increasing protein from 15% to 30% of total calories resulted in consuming 441 fewer calories per day and losing 11 pounds over 12 weeks.
Is 50 Grams Right for You?
Protein needs are highly individualized and depend on your age, activity level, and health goals. For some, 50 grams is a powerful tool, while for others, it may be more than necessary.
Who benefits from 50 grams of protein?
- Athletes and Bodybuilders: Individuals engaged in intense resistance training or endurance sports have higher protein needs (1.2–2.0 g/kg of body weight) for muscle repair and growth. A 50g breakfast helps them meet their daily targets and kickstarts muscle protein synthesis after an overnight fast.
- Older Adults: Sarcopenia, the age-related loss of muscle mass, is a major health concern. Higher protein intake (1.2–1.6 g/kg) can help combat this. A protein-rich breakfast can be a strategic way to distribute protein intake evenly throughout the day.
- Weight Loss: As discussed, the high satiety from protein can be a game-changer for weight loss, helping to manage appetite and reduce snacking.
Who should be cautious?
- Sedentary Individuals: For a less active person, 50 grams of protein in one meal is likely excessive. The body will use what it needs for synthesis and energy, but any surplus calories—from any macronutrient—will be stored as fat.
- Those with Kidney Issues: High protein intake can put extra strain on the kidneys. Anyone with pre-existing kidney conditions should consult a doctor or registered dietitian before starting a high-protein diet.
Comparison: 50g vs. Standard Breakfast
| Feature | 50g Protein Breakfast | Standard 20g Protein Breakfast |
|---|---|---|
| Satiety (Fullness) | Very High. Keeps you full for hours, significantly reducing mid-morning hunger and cravings. | Moderate. Satisfying but less likely to prevent snacking completely before lunch. |
| Muscle Protein Synthesis | High. Maximizes and extends the anabolic response, especially for active individuals or older adults. | Moderate. Sufficient for most people to stimulate MPS but less effective for peak muscle growth. |
| Weight Management | Effective tool. Promotes fat loss by boosting metabolism and suppressing appetite. | Supports healthy weight. Adequate protein helps maintain a healthy weight and prevent overeating. |
| Digestive Process | Slower absorption due to larger volume and complex food sources. Best with sufficient water. | Faster, more efficient absorption for smaller meals. |
| Dietary Balance | Can be challenging to balance with other macros and micronutrients if not planned carefully. | Easier to balance with carbohydrates and healthy fats. |
| Metabolic Effect | Significant boost due to the high thermic effect of protein. | Smaller, but still positive, metabolic effect. |
How to Build a 50g Protein Breakfast
Achieving 50 grams of protein in a single meal requires intentional planning and smart food choices. You can combine whole foods or use supplements strategically.
- Eggs and Cottage Cheese Bowl: Scramble 4 large eggs (24g) with 1 cup of cottage cheese (25g). Add spinach for extra nutrients. Protein total: ~49g.
- Protein Oatmeal: Mix 1 scoop of protein powder (25g) into ½ cup of rolled oats. Top with 1 cup of Greek yogurt (20g), 1 tablespoon of peanut butter (4g), and berries. Protein total: ~49g.
- Chicken and Veggie Scramble: Cook 5 ounces of chicken breast (40g) and scramble with 2 eggs (12g) and mixed vegetables. Serve with avocado. Protein total: ~52g.
- High-Protein Smoothie: Blend 1.5 scoops of protein powder (37g), 1 cup of Greek yogurt (20g), 1 tablespoon of chia seeds (3g), and a handful of spinach. Protein total: ~60g.
- Turkey Sausage and Egg White Bowl: Cook 2 turkey sausage links (10g) with 1 cup of liquid egg whites (25g) and ½ cup of black beans (8g). Top with shredded cheese (4g) and avocado. Protein total: ~47g.
Conclusion
Whether 50 grams of protein is a good amount for your breakfast depends on your individual needs and lifestyle. For sedentary individuals, a dose this high may be unnecessary and could simply contribute to excess calories. However, for those with higher protein requirements—like athletes, older adults, and individuals focused on weight management or muscle building—it can be a highly effective strategy to maximize satiety and stimulate muscle protein synthesis throughout the day. The key is to source this protein from nutrient-dense whole foods and maintain a balanced diet. As with any significant dietary change, it is wise to consult a healthcare provider or a registered dietitian for personalized advice tailored to your health goals and needs.
